Article: Sumitomo Bakelite buys Resins maker in Spain.(Europe/Mideast)(Fers Resin)(Brief Article)

Sumitomo Bakelite (Tokyo) says it has acquired phenolic resins producer Fers Resin (Barcelona) for an undisclosed sum. The acquisition was carried out by Durez Spain, an affiliate of Sumitomo Bakelite subsidiary Durez Europe (Genk, Belgium). Durez Spain has been renamed Fers Europe.

Fenocast (Barcelona), the manufacturing arm of Fers, has capacity for 12,000 m.t./year of solid phenolic resins and 6,000 m.t./year of liquid resins. Fers has sales of about 31 million [euro] ($34 million)/year.
